However, it's also helpful to look at the criticisms from the community. Some users have pointed out issues such as a “throttle deadzone” problem with certain radio controllers, where input at the top and bottom of the stick range isn't registered accurately. Another widespread criticism, mentioned by several pilots, is the “bouncy” collision physics where drones spring off surfaces like a rubber ball, which feels far from realistic. Some also note the lack of a built-in tutorial and the relatively limited number of maps available in the early access version.

First-Person View (FPV) flying has revolutionized the drone hobby, transforming it from aerial photography into an adrenaline-pumping, immersive sport. However, the steep learning curve and the high cost of crashing real-world drones make simulators essential. Enter , a rising star in the FPV simulator market that promises near-real physics and a comprehensive flying experience.
